Socials: OpenArt Worlds lets you turn images or prompts into fully explorable 3D environments — no setup or technical workflow required. Start with a single image, and Worlds instantly generates a navigable 3D space you can walk through, explore, and build inside. What begins as static inspiration becomes an immersive environment ready for storytelling, visualization, or creative experimentation. Once inside your world, you can freely direct every scene. Place characters, objects, and lighting exactly where you want, adjust camera angles, and stage compositions in real time. Every change updates instantly, giving creators full control over visual direction. Built for professional creative pipelines, OpenArt Worlds supports export in 3D Gaussian Splat format, allowing seamless integration with tools like Blender and Unreal Engine. Continue production outside the platform without losing environment fidelity or creative control. Every world you create is saved permanently in your OpenArt library, enabling long-term reuse and consistent environments across videos, posts, and projects.
